Pennsylvania coverlet by Solomon Kuter, 1835, tied beiderwand
Entry/Object ID
2017.1.031
Description
Figured coverlet; blue cotton and red wool, tied double cloth (Beiderwand). Coverlet is made up of two panels joined by a central seam. Selvedges on either side. Top and bottom hemmed with fringe attached to both sides and bottom of coverlet. Central motif of circular medallions with a central diamond. Secondary design of small medallions. Center panel has a spotted ground. Border on both sides and bottom of highly stylized flowers and trees. Corner block with woven text at each bottom corner.
